    Hoax Slayer (stylized as Hoax-Slayer) was a fact-checking website [2] [3] established in 2003 by Brett Christensen, dedicated to critically analyzing the veracity of urban legends. While it was best known for debunking false stories and internet scams, it also hosted a page listing strange but true stories. [4] [5]
